Output ef24c70b341667d7fe93c44f82790fd1c367d564b0b9539e463f44ebbc711256:10

value
942482
script pubkey
OP_0 OP_PUSHBYTES_20 a8098bd1b11f9a2e04eacf12f7c0b515fcd93551
address
bc1q4qych5d3r7dzup82euf00s94zh7djd23j0568r
transaction
ef24c70b341667d7fe93c44f82790fd1c367d564b0b9539e463f44ebbc711256